Abstract

<jats:sec> <jats:title>Background and Purpose—</jats:title> <jats:p>Ischemic stroke induced by thrombosis may be triggered by atherosclerotic plaque rupture and collagen-induced platelet activation. Collagen induces glycoprotein VI shedding.</jats:p> </jats:sec> <jats:sec> <jats:title>Methods—</jats:title> <jats:p>We measured plasma-soluble glycoprotein VI (sGPVI) by enzyme-linked immunosorbent assay in 159 patients with acute (<7-day) ischemic stroke and age/sex-matched community-based control subjects.</jats:p> </jats:sec> <jats:sec> <jats:title>Results—</jats:title> <jats:p> sGPVI was elevated in stroke compared with controls ( <jats:italic>P</jats:italic> =0.0168). ORs were higher in Quartile 4 for stroke cases ( <jats:italic>P</jats:italic> =0.0121), and sGPVI was significantly elevated in stroke associated with large artery disease across Quartiles 2 to 4 and small artery disease in Quartile 4. sGPVI decreased 3 to 6 months after antiplatelet treatment, consistent with elevated sGPVI due to platelet activation during the thrombotic event. sGPVI correlated with P-selectin ( <jats:italic>P</jats:italic> =0.0007) and was higher in individuals with the GPVI <jats:italic>a</jats:italic> haplotype ( <jats:italic>P</jats:italic> =0.024). </jats:p> </jats:sec> <jats:sec> <jats:title>Conclusion—</jats:title> <jats:p>Glycoprotein VI shedding is implicated in the pathology of acute ischemic stroke.</jats:p> </jats:sec>
